From the fifth (sometimes sixth) semester onwards, students become eligible for campus placements. Many big companies visit the campus for placements such as ICICI bank and others. The packages offered to graduate freshers from Prestige are slightly better than those offered to freshers of other institutes. Employability is also better for freshers from Prestige. A few students have also been placed abroad in countries like UAE.
The college begins providing internship opportunities once you reach the third semester/ second year. The firms which provide internships to Prestige students are not so big. The internship stipend generally ranges from 4000 to 8000. Permanent job opportunities are provided from the fifth semester onwards. Several big institutions such as Bank of America, Career Launcher, ICICI bank, etc. come to the campus for placements.

Placement assistance is available for the students. The students become eligible for placement in 4th year i.e., from the seventh semester. Various law firms visit the college for providing placement opportunities.
The Training and Placement cell assures that every student gets an internship starting from the first year of college. Even during the COVID-19 period, the college provided internship opportunities in online mode under reputed Advocates. The college also provides internships with various government bodies and even the Supreme court.
